Tai Chi & Qi Gong
Starts Monday 10th May 2021, 11am via Zoom (continues on 17th, 24th May and 7th June)
Join this zoom class for 45 minutes of light exercise known as Qi Gong and Tai Chi.
These movements are all about gently moving your body to breathe better and to stretch and loosen your joints. You can sit or stand, there is no lying on the floor and you work to your own level. The tutor (who has been working with the Portslade over 50s Activities Group for 12 years) will guide you through exercises you can remember and practice on a daily basis for enhanced wellbeing.

Mill View Carers Support Group
Run by Sussex Partnership NHS Trust, this is a monthly support group for carers of those who use our acute mental health services. Facilitated by a member of staff, it offers emotional support and practical advice by and for carers.
The support group is held on the 2nd Friday of every month, 2:45pm - 4:15pm, on the Mill View Site and Carers don't need to book in advance. On the day, please present at reception for room location or in advance, please e-mail: nicholas.mcmaster@sussexpartnership.nhs.uk
